Real-time spectrum analysis technology becomes a new technology of spectrum analysis with the development of digital signal processing technique, it is able to monitor and analyze the weak signal, the burst signal, also can analysis the signal in the time domain, frequency domain, spemodulation domain, which is important for spectrum monitoring.However most of the real-time spectrum monitoring equipments have the following 3 defects:(1) The equipments are most bulky, expensive, inconvenient to carry;(2) The interface and the function is simple, and the software is difficult to operate,and is hard to integrate other applications;(3) Its data is less compatible with other-field equipments, namely it is hard tocheck the data on the other-field equipments.This thesis design the real-time spectrum monitoring software on our hardware platform which is miniature, energy-saving, easy to carry, etc. The software platform is the Android operating system, which has considerable advantages on the beauty of the system, the function and data compatibility. The main contribution of this thesis is as follows:Firstly, according to the software requirements, the software is divided into three functions about monitoring weak signals, burst signals, analysising the disturbing state of the required frequency point, displaying the information for the guidance of the spectrum monitoring equipment, the thesis designs the entire interface for interaction with the user, and provides the whole process of the operation.Secondly, the thesis proposes the framework of the software and gives the detail of the software design. The software is devised into three layers, namely displaying layer, business layer, data processing layer. Then the thesis discusses them, and gives the process and solution of the layers in detail.Finally, this thesis tests the software in the aspects of function and performance, and gives the platform, the methods of the software tests, and analyzes the results. The results show that the software can complete functional requirements and meet the demands, at the same time, the throughput rate of collecting spectrum data can reach 20.6 frames per second.The study of real-time spectrum monitoring on the platform of Android provides a solution of the business development to the direction of portability and miniaturization, but also this thesis addes a new software application for the Android platform, which has certain practical value.
